Solar and the feed-in tariff in Keighley
1,004 installations are accredited under the Feed-in Tariff here, holding 5,972 kW of capacity. That ranks the constituency 391 of 633 and accounts for 0.12% of every FIT installation in the country.

When they went up
Like most of the country, Keighley front-loaded: the busiest year was 2011, before the tariff cuts began to bite.
What is installed
| Technology | Installations |
|---|---|
| Photovoltaic | 983 |
| Wind | 21 |
Domestic and everything else
| Installation type | Installations |
|---|---|
| Domestic | 952 |
| Non Domestic (Commercial) | 48 |
| Community | 3 |
| Non Domestic (Industrial) | 1 |
